I introduced a USB stick (I have Kaspersky 7 antivirus), nothing was found but... regedit was disable, task manager was disabled, safeboot from registry was deleted (when I try to boot in Safe mode the computer restarts), and Hidden files and folders are constantly hidden (I choose to show them but in seconds disapear).
On the USB stick I found 2 files hidden: autorun.inf and jnll.exe). After the virus was activated, on the stick apeard a file named: Entertainment Pack Minesweeper Game.exe.
I make the same above on other comp (that I use for tests and other) and on the stick I found the same autorun.inf and ttnsws.pif. Same modifications on the second comp (Avast 4.7 was running on this - nothing found).
